## On-Call Notes: Pickwright Optimizer

Pickwright generates pick-lists for the Hollowbin warehouse network. If the route solver hangs, restart the Cartline worker pool first. Escalations go through the Binfall channel. Emergency admin access to the solver console is gated; it requires the standing recovery passphrase, which appears below.

vault phrase of bagaf-kajeg = jorath-feniel-briir-siliel-ralix

/*
 * Client setup for Verdanta, the plant-watering scheduler.
 * Reviewer notes: the client talks to our internal Drizzlecore
 * forecast service to adjust watering intervals by humidity.
 * Timeouts are deliberately short (800ms) because a stale
 * forecast is acceptable but a blocked scheduler tick is not.
 * Retries use jittered backoff, capped at three attempts.
 * The Drizzlecore client authenticates with the service key
 * given on the next line.
 */

gateway credential: kto3_qfe

Prepared for the finance team by G. Ollenbeck.

Current-year training spend closed 8% under allocation. Proposal: hold next year's budget flat, reallocating the surplus toward certification programmes for the Dunmere analytics group. Vendor rates from Quillart Learning rose 4%; offset by dropping two underused workshop series. Headcount growth assumptions remain unchanged. Approval needed before the planning cycle locks at month-end. One strategic consideration shapes this allocation and is recorded in the confidential note below.

board note of bawep-tajef: Queniusek Systems plans to raise the Quenvan list price by 53.1 percent in March. The pricing group signed off on a budget of $176.4 million for Project Drueth. The renewal with Casionix Partners closes at $142.5 million a year, 8.3 percent below the last contract. Project Fraax slips by six weeks because of the tooling delay.